Opening the cabinet
The HAM263D master control unit is protected from opening by a built-in tamper switch. Opening
the cabinet door will trigger the alarm.
• Before opening the cabinet, put the system in stand-by mode. To do this, disarm the system via
the keypad. Refer to the section on the keypad for the procedure.
